NEET UG 2027 CBT Mode: NTA Announces Biggest Change in Medical Entrance Exam, Check New Pattern, Reasons & Benefits

For years, lakhs of medical students have appeared for NEET UG using the traditional pen-and-paper method. However, that is set to change. The National Testing Agency (NTA) has announced that NEET 2027 will be conducted with a Computer-Based Test (CBT) mode which is one of the biggest changes that have ever occurred in India's entrance test.

This move follows the controversy over the NEET's UG exam in 2026 in which allegations relating to leaks of paper and security breaches, as well as inconsistencies raised a lot of concern for parents, students, and experts in education. To bring back confidence in the system and to make the examination procedure more transparent the government has opted to establish a digital exam system that is backed by more secure security measures.

If you're preparing for NEET 2027 UG, here's all you must be aware of the new exam format as well as the motivations of the change, as well as what the students are likely to encounter.

Why is NEET UG Moving to CBT Mode?

The decision to change NEET UG 2027 to Computer-Based Test mode is primarily designed to make the exam more secure, fairer and more reliable.

The incidents of NEET 2026's UG brought out a variety of issues in running one of the nation's biggest entrance exams. The revelations of leaks in question papers and other irregularities led the government to examine the entire process of examination.

After considering a variety of alternatives, officials concluded that a digitally-enabled exam could help lower the risks of paper-based exams and also provide better oversight throughout the test.

The change is anticipated to increase its credibility test and provide a safe environment for legitimate candidates.

NEET UG 2027: Major Changes Announced

Numerous significant reforms have been suggested in conjunction with the switch towards CBT mode.

1. Computer-Based Test (CBT) Format

Starting with NEET UG 2027, the candidates will have to respond to questions via computers instead of writing answers in the OMR sheet.

The syllabus and the difficulty level will continue to be in line with the curriculum prescribed However, the process of the test is expected to completely change.

2. Around 1,000 Exam Centres Across India

In order to conduct a massive exam efficiently the government is planning to establish more than 1,000 exam centers that use computers all over the nation.

These centers will be equipped with standard computer systems as well as safe testing infrastructures to ensure consistency.

3. Exam May Be Conducted in Multiple Shifts

As opposed to previous years when each candidate appeared on the same date, NEET UG 2027 could be spread over several shifts or days.

This will make it easier to accommodate the huge number of applicants while also easing pressure on exam centers.

Authorities are expected to apply normalization techniques, if necessary to ensure fairness across various shifts.

4. AI-Based Monitoring and Digital Surveillance

One of the most important developments is the use in the field of Artificial Intelligence (AI) and advanced technology for surveillance.

The new system could comprise:

  • AI-powered monitoring of candidates
  • Live CCTV surveillance
  • Biometric verification
  • Digital attendance systems
  • Automated detection of suspicious activity

The measures are intended to limit unfair practices during the exam.

5. Stronger Security Against Paper Leaks

Since the exam is computer-based, authorities believe that the chance of leaks from paper can be drastically diminished.

Secured and encrypted question papers and secure server access restricted digital access and monitoring in real-time are expected to improve the process of examination.

Why This Change Matters for Students

The change to CBT mode goes beyond simply replacing the paper with computers. It alters the way that students take part in the test.

Instead of filling out bubbles within or an OMR sheet, students will pick their answers directly from the screen.

Students will also be able to access options like:

  • On-screen question navigation
  • Digital timer
  • Easy question review
  • Option to mark-for-review
  • Instant response recording

People who have experience with computer-based exams like JEE Main will find the interface easier to comprehend with enough practice.

Will the NEET UG 2027 Syllabus Change?

At present, the announcement focuses on the manner of testing.

There has been no official confirmation regarding major changes in the NEET UG 2027 syllabus. Students must continue to prepare in accordance with the most recent syllabus that has been approved by the authorities until a new notification is issued.

The marking scheme and the number of questions and duration of the exam are likely to be specified in the official bulletin of information.

How Should Aspirants Prepare for CBT Mode?

Students who are preparing to take NEET's UG exam 2027 must begin preparing for examinations using computers as early as possible.

A few helpful tips for preparation include:

  • Make sure you take on-line mock tests frequently.
  • Enhance speed of answering computer-generated questions.
  • Learn to control your mouse and keyboard for smooth and easy navigation.
  • Solve full-length CBT practice papers under timed conditions.
  • Be focused on accuracy, not trying to answer questions quickly.

Making yourself comfortable with the computer interface can help ease anxiety during the exam.
